Output d6644abca223b08470c435bd651b13500c5e28c42f6a96f80af0b017a774b1cc:3

value
596982
script pubkey
OP_0 OP_PUSHBYTES_20 e26eb8c2f4054a55b1d3eb54f83cd43b1ec24b90
address
bc1qufht3sh5q499tvwnad20s0x58v0vyjus3clele
transaction
d6644abca223b08470c435bd651b13500c5e28c42f6a96f80af0b017a774b1cc
spent
true